Abstract

The utility model discloses a feeding device for a semiconductor product material pipe, which belongs to the technical field of semiconductors and comprises a moving frame, an assistor and a water pump, wherein wheels are embedded and connected to the bottom of the moving frame, the top of the moving frame is connected with the assistor in a welding mode, a placing groove is formed in the inner side wall of the assistor, one end of the placing groove is provided with a plastic push plate a, the top of the plastic push plate a is embedded and connected with an electric telescopic rod a, one end of the placing groove is provided with a plastic push plate b, one end of the plastic push plate b is embedded and connected with an electric telescopic rod b, the bottom of the electric telescopic rod b is connected with a bracket, an inserting port is formed in the bottom of the placing groove, the outer side wall of the assistor is embedded and connected with a control button, and the bottom of the assistor is embedded and connected with a water feeder. The utility model ensures the safety of products, improves the stability and efficiency of work, ensures the cleanness of the device by the water feeder, and avoids the condition that the auxiliary device is blocked by residual garbage and dust to cause the incapability of use.

Background
In the production and manufacturing process of semiconductor products, after the semiconductor is packaged, the semiconductor products are generally placed into a semiconductor product tube (also called a packaging tube or a packaging tube), the traditional operation method is to clamp and transport the semiconductor products into the tube by a feeding arm, and after the tube is filled with the semiconductor products, the tube is sealed by a baffle strip.
The patent number CN201821497756.1 discloses a feeding device for assisting semiconductor products to enter a feeding pipe, which comprises an installation bottom plate and a feeding pipe horizontally placed on the installation bottom plate, wherein a belt conveyor is arranged on one side of the installation bottom plate, a plurality of semiconductor products are arranged on the belt conveyor, the semiconductor products are conveyed to a pipe orifice at one end of the feeding pipe through the belt conveyor, and a material pushing mechanism for pushing the semiconductor products into the feeding pipe is arranged on one side of the belt conveyor. Has the advantages that: the feeding device for assisting the semiconductor products to enter the feeding pipe can automatically and continuously feed the semiconductor products into the cylindrical feeding pipe, manual filling is not needed, the filling speed is high, the efficiency is high, the labor cost is greatly reduced, and the practicability is good.
The feeding devices of the prior art have the following disadvantages: 1. the feeding is not stable enough, the protection to the product is not good, the speed is too fast, and the product is easy to damage; 2. the condition that equipment can not be used is easily caused by poor post-maintenance cleaning, and therefore a feeding device for a semiconductor product material pipe is provided.

Referring to fig. 1 and 2, the feeding device for a semiconductor product material pipe provided by the embodiment of the utility model comprises a moving frame 1, an auxiliary device 3 and a water pump 15, wherein wheels 2 are connected to the bottom of the moving frame 1 in an embedded manner, the auxiliary device 3 is connected to the top of the moving frame 1 in a welded manner, a placing groove 4 is formed in the inner side wall of the auxiliary device 3, a plastic push plate a6 is arranged at one end of the placing groove 4, an electric telescopic rod a5 is connected to the top of the plastic push plate a6 in an embedded manner, a plastic push plate b9 is arranged at one end of the placing groove 4, an electric telescopic rod b8 is connected to one end of the plastic push plate b9 in an embedded manner, a bracket 7 is connected to the bottom of the electric telescopic rod b8, an insertion port 11 is formed in the bottom of the placing groove 4, a control button 10 is connected to the outer side wall of the auxiliary device 3 in an embedded manner, and a water feeder 12 is connected to the bottom of the auxiliary device 3 in an embedded manner.
Illustratively, the wheels 2 embedded at the bottom of the movable frame 1 are convenient for workers to move, the device is moved, the convenience and the flexibility of the device are improved, the labor is saved, the assistor 3 welded at the top of the movable frame 1 is a main part for smoothly and quickly conveying semiconductor products to a material pipe, a placing groove 4 arranged in the assistor 3 can be used for simultaneously placing a large number of semiconductor products, the workers are placed in the placing groove 4 after composing, the electric telescopic rod b8 connected with the plastic push plate b9 provides power for the workers to push the semiconductor products to the right, and the plastic push pedal a6 that standing groove 4 right-hand member set up, the electric telescopic handle a5 of connecting through the top can push the semiconductor product that pushes away downwards, and stable through the grafting port 11 reachs in the material pipe, the effect of packing is better, has ensured the security of product, has improved the stability and the efficiency of work.
Referring to fig. 1 and 2, a water filling port 13 is arranged on the outer side wall of the water feeder 12, a water pumping pipe 14 is connected to the inner side wall of the water feeder 12 in a penetrating manner, and a water pump 15 is connected to one end of the water pumping pipe 14 in an embedded manner.
In the example, the water injection port 13 injects water into the water feeder 12 to ensure subsequent water use, and the water pump 15 extracts the water through the water pumping pipe 14 for use.
Referring to fig. 1 and 2, a guide pipe 16 is embedded and connected to the bottom of the water pump 15, and a spray head 17 is detachably connected to one end of the guide pipe 16.
Illustratively, water pumped by a water pump 15 is delivered through a conduit 16 and sprayed out through a spray head 17 for cleaning the device.
Referring to fig. 1, a bracket 18 is welded to the top of the auxiliary device 3, a hand grip 19 is welded to the outer side wall of the bracket 18, and a lighting lamp 20 is embedded and connected to the outer side wall of the bracket 18.
In the illustrated example, the support 18 welded to the auxiliary device 3 is embedded with a lighting lamp 20 to provide a visual field for work in low light, and the grip 19 is held by hand to help the worker push the device.
Referring to fig. 1 and 2, the electric telescopic rod a5, the electric telescopic rod b8 and the water pump 15 are connected with an external power supply through wires.
In an example, a power supply is connected to ensure the normal operation of the electric telescopic rod a5, the electric telescopic rod b8 and the water pump 15.
